The removal of wisdom teeth, or third molars, is a common surgical procedure. This procedure involves the surgical removal of teeth, which results in a temporary wound in the jawbone and gum tissue. A frequent concern following the procedure is a throbbing sensation at the extraction site. Understanding this post-operative discomfort as a normal part of the body’s healing process is the first step toward a smooth recovery.
Understanding Expected Post-Extraction Throbbing
The throbbing sensation felt after surgery is a direct physiological consequence of the body initiating its repair mechanism. This rhythmic pulsating is caused by localized swelling and increased blood flow to the surgical area. The body sends white blood cells and healing factors to the site to begin tissue regeneration, which temporarily increases pressure in the surrounding vessels.
This discomfort is most pronounced during the first 24 to 48 hours following the extraction, when post-surgical inflammation typically peaks. As the initial trauma resolves, the throbbing pain should gradually decrease in intensity. The throbbing is a sign that the body is working to form a protective blood clot and close the wound.
Nerve endings temporarily irritated during the surgical process also contribute to the throbbing feeling. Even after the initial peak, a dull ache or light throbbing may persist for up to a week. This expected timeline of decreasing intensity is the primary indicator of a successful and normal recovery.
Actionable Steps for Pain Management
Managing post-operative throbbing involves a combination of pharmaceutical and physical interventions aimed at controlling inflammation. Pharmacological management often alternates between non-steroidal anti-inflammatory drugs and acetaminophen, taken as directed by the surgeon. It is most effective to take pain medication before the local anesthetic fully wears off, maintaining a steady level of relief.
Immediate physical management focuses on reducing swelling, which minimizes throbbing pressure. Applying a cold compress or ice pack to the cheek for 15-minute intervals during the first day constricts blood vessels and limits the inflammatory response. When resting, keep the head elevated slightly above the heart; this uses gravity to reduce blood flow and pressure to the surgical site.
Patient activity and diet play a substantial role in controlling pain levels. Avoiding strenuous physical activity for the first several days is important, as elevated heart rate and blood pressure increase the throbbing sensation. Dietary restrictions, such as sticking to soft foods and avoiding straws, prevent mechanical irritation to the blood clot. Sucking actions create negative pressure that can dislodge the clot, leading to increased pain.
Recognizing Signs of Potential Complications
While some throbbing is expected, pain that deviates from the normal recovery timeline may signal a complication requiring professional attention. The distinction between normal healing and a complication rests on the pain’s severity, persistence, and change over time. If the throbbing pain suddenly intensifies three or more days after the procedure, it may indicate a condition like dry socket.
Dry socket, or alveolar osteitis, occurs when the protective blood clot is lost, exposing the underlying bone and nerve endings. This condition presents as intense, radiating pain that may extend to the ear, temple, or neck, often accompanied by a foul taste or odor. Unlike normal throbbing that improves, dry socket pain becomes excruciating and unmanageable with standard pain relievers.
Signs of a post-operative infection are distinct and require immediate contact with the dental office. These signs include swelling that continues to worsen or spreads beyond the jaw after the first few days, pus draining from the socket, or the development of a fever. Any persistent or worsening symptoms that do not follow the expected pattern of gradual improvement should be evaluated by the oral surgeon.
